Acknowledgement & Appreciation
We extend our sincere gratitude to the City of Edmonton for their generous support. ACSA was proud to host Breaking the Silence: A Cultural Healing Gathering , a two-day, culturally grounded awareness event open to all community members. The gathering brought together Elders, Knowledge Keepers, and community members to share teachings and lived experiences around family violence and healing. Listen Now: A Conversation About the Circle of Safety Program
Hear Keleigh Larson , Executive Director of Aboriginal Counseling Services of Alberta, discuss the Circle of Safety program , which helps women fleeing domestic violence. Learn about the programโ€™s impact on our community and the challenges it faces as it seeks funding for the future.
